Waikiki Queen

Waikiki Queen is a tropical sativa-dominant hybrid (70/30) from Amsterdam Marijuana Seeds, crossing Hawaii Sativa with White Queen. With 19-24% THC and a Myrcene-rich terpene profile, this strain delivers uplifting euphoria paired with gentle body relaxation. Expect sweet pineapple and tropical fruit flavors, energizing yet focused effects, and versatile anytime use. Perfect for creative projects, social situations, and stress relief without heavy sedation.

THC% tells you how strong. Terpenes tell you how it feels.

THC percentage is a property of the product in your hand, not of the strain. It shifts with the batch, the grower, the harvest, and how the flower was cured and stored — the same strain can test several points apart from two different jars.

Treat the ranges below as market context for what to expect on a shelf — then read the actual label on the product you are buying, and use the terpene profile to judge how it will feel.

Aloha to Island Euphoria

Waikiki Queen is a sativa-dominant hybrid (70% Sativa / 30% Indica) that captures the essence of Hawaiian paradise in cannabis form. Bred by Amsterdam Marijuana Seeds (AMS), this tropical powerhouse combines the legendary Hawaii Sativa landrace with the resinous White Queen to create a strain that delivers sun-kissed euphoria with a sophisticated edge. With THC levels ranging from 19-24% and a modest CBD content of 0.24-2%, Waikiki Queen offers a balanced cannabinoid profile that appeals to both recreational enthusiasts and those seeking therapeutic benefits. This strain has earned its reputation as an all-day companion that energizes the mind while gently cradling the body in relaxation.

🧬 Genetic Heritage & Lineage

The lineage of Waikiki Queen tells a story of East meets West in the cannabis world. The Hawaii Sativa parent brings pure landrace genetics from the volcanic islands, carrying centuries of natural selection and adaptation to tropical climates. This legendary Hawaiian strain contributes the uplifting, energetic qualities and tropical flavor profile that define the experience. White Queen, the European counterpart, adds resin production, potency, and structure to the mix—traits that make this hybrid both powerful and cultivation-friendly. Amsterdam Marijuana Seeds masterfully combined these genetics to create a strain that honors its island roots while delivering the consistency and punch that modern cannabis consumers expect. The result is a 70/30 sativa-dominant blend that leans energetic but never leaves you racing.

👃 Terpene Profile & Aromatics

Waikiki Queen's aromatic signature is led by Myrcene at 0.77%, which might seem counterintuitive for a sativa-dominant strain, but this terpene provides the body-relaxing foundation that balances the cerebral effects. Caryophyllene follows at 0.35%, adding spicy, peppery notes while acting as a CB2 receptor agonist for anti-inflammatory benefits. Limonene rounds out the profile at 0.09%, contributing bright citrus notes and mood-elevating properties. With a total terpene content of 1.21%, the nose on this strain explodes with tropical fruit, fresh pineapple, and sweet citrus, backed by earthy undertones and subtle pine. You'll also detect floral notes, berry sweetness, and even hints of pear and grape in well-cured samples. 👅 Flavor Experience

The flavor journey of Waikiki Queen mirrors its aromatic promise with remarkable tropical authenticity. On the inhale, you'll encounter sweet pineapple and mixed tropical fruits that immediately transport your palate to island shores. The mid-palate reveals citrus brightness with berry undertones, while subtle notes of grape and even cheese add unexpected complexity. The exhale finishes with sweet pine and earthy notes that ground the tropical sweetness. Some phenotypes display interesting pear-like flavors that add to the fruit salad experience. The smoke is typically smooth and sweet, making this an enjoyable strain for extended sessions without harshness.

🎯 Effects & Experience

Waikiki Queen delivers a dynamic, multifaceted high that begins with cerebral uplift and evolves into full-body satisfaction. Within 5-10 minutes of consumption, you'll notice mood elevation, euphoria, and increased mental clarity. The sativa dominance shines through with energizing effects that spark creativity and conversation—users consistently report feeling talkative, focused, and happy. Unlike purely energetic strains, the Myrcene content provides gentle relaxation that prevents anxiety or overstimulation. The peak experience lasts 2-3 hours, during which you'll feel simultaneously motivated and at ease. This makes Waikiki Queen exceptional for daytime use, social situations, creative projects, and active relaxation. The comedown is gradual and pleasant, leaving you feeling content rather than crashed.

👁️ Visual Characteristics

Waikiki Queen buds display tropical beauty with dense, sativa-leaning structure. Expect forest green and lime-colored flowers adorned with vibrant orange to rust-colored pistils that stand out dramatically against the foliage. Quality examples showcase generous trichome coverage that gives buds a frosted, crystalline appearance—testament to the White Queen genetics. The buds are medium-dense with good resin production, making them sticky to the touch when fresh. Well-grown Waikiki Queen displays purple undertones in cooler growing conditions, adding to the visual appeal.
